Celebrate LGBTQ+ Pride Month at San Lorenzo Library and uplift local Queer voices and creativity! All are invited to a day full of fun celebrating creativity, inclusion, diversity, and art. This event will feature fun for the whole family including speaker panels from queer authors and artists, crafts, prize drawings, comic and zine creation, appearances from local queer artists and zinesters, and more!
Opening ceremony will begin at noon! Don’t miss out!
Presentations throughout the day include:
- Our Stories Matter: Censored Authors Discuss Their Banned Books – feat. MariNaomi, Katryn Bury
- A Discussion of Local Comic & Book Stores as Queer Spaces – feat. owners of A.B.O. Comix Collective & Silver Sprocket
- Queer Representation in AfroFuturism – feat. professor, author and artist, Ajuan Mance; owner of Sistah Sci-Fi Book Store, Isis Asarae; & author, Duane Horton
- What is Waacking?: Introduction & Dance Class – feat. Kristie Lui of Rae Studios
- Cosplay Fashion Show – feat. Cosplay with Pride & Bay Area Bounty Hunters
- Appearances from community resources: Oakland Black Pride, Bay Area Queer Zine Fest, Planned Parenthood, Oakland LGBTQ Center, Community Resources for Independent Living (CRIL)
